jQuery漏洞及其影响与应对策略

2025-05-25 AI文章 阅读 1

在互联网时代,JavaScript库如jQuery因其简洁易用而被广泛应用于网页开发中,随着时间的推移,jQuery也暴露出了许多安全问题,其中最引人关注的就是其内置的漏洞——“远程代码执行”(Remote Code Execution)。

什么是jQuery漏洞?

jQuery是一个基于DOM选择器的JavaScript库,主要用于创建交互式网站和web应用程序,它为开发者提供了简化Web开发的过程,并且极大地提高了开发效率,在使用jQuery时,如果开发者不注意某些细节或使用不当,可能会引入各种安全隐患。

jQuery漏洞的影响

  1. 远程代码执行:这是最常见的jQuery漏洞之一,攻击者可以通过恶意利用这些漏洞,将服务器上的任意代码注入到用户的浏览器中运行。
  2. 跨站脚本攻击:这种类型的攻击涉及向用户展示经过篡改的HTML页面,通过恶意脚本来窃取用户的个人信息、账户信息等敏感数据。
  3. 跨站点请求伪造:这是一种更隐蔽的攻击方式,攻击者可以诱使受害者访问包含恶意脚本的网页,从而获取受害者的信任并进一步进行其他恶意活动。

应对策略

  1. 定期更新jQuery:保持jQuery的最新版本至关重要,因为新的补丁通常会修复已知的安全漏洞。
  2. 避免直接引用第三方库:尽量通过CDN(内容分发网络)来加载jQuery,这样可以减少潜在的安全风险。
  3. 限制权限:确保只有必要的JavaScript文件被加载到您的项目中,避免不必要的脚本加载。
  4. 使用防恶意插件:安装一些专门用于检测和阻止XSS攻击的插件,如OWASP ESAPI,可以帮助保护您的应用免受这类攻击。
  5. 教育员工:加强对团队成员的安全培训,提高他们识别和防范安全威胁的能力。

虽然jQuery作为一种强大的工具对现代Web开发具有不可替代的价值,但必须认识到它的局限性和潜在的风险,采取适当的防护措施,不仅可以有效降低黑客攻击的风险,还可以增强网站的整体安全性。

相关推荐

  • 警惕,网络陷阱中的赌博骗局

    在互联网的广阔世界里,许多人寻找着逃避现实压力的方式,这往往伴随着巨大的风险和潜在的非法行为,一项调查揭示了一个令人不安的现象——大量的网站正在通过各种手段诱骗人们点击“在线赌博”链接,从而将他们引向犯罪深渊。 这些网站通常伪装成合法、安全且娱乐性质的平台,但它们实际...

    0AI文章2025-05-25
  • 绿盟传奇登录器生成器官方网站

    在网络安全领域,绿盟科技以其专业的技术和丰富的经验赢得了广泛的认可,绿盟科技正式推出了其自主研发的传奇登录器生成器——“绿盟传奇登录器生成器”,这款产品不仅填补了市场上的空白,而且在保护用户隐私和保障网络信息安全方面发挥了重要作用。 什么是绿盟传奇登录器生成器? 绿...

    0AI文章2025-05-25
  • 全国高校心理MOOC证书的获取途径与流程

    随着社会的发展和科技的进步,高等教育逐渐从传统模式转向数字化、网络化的趋势,在这种背景下,“慕课”(MOOCs)作为在线教育的一种重要形式应运而生,并迅速成为全球范围内提升教育质量的重要工具,一些优质的心理学课程通过MOOC平台提供给全球学生,帮助他们学习心理健康知识和...

    0AI文章2025-05-25
  • 高效沟通与协作,GRADE研究的创新实践

    在医疗领域中,有效沟通和团队协作对于提高治疗效果至关重要,一项名为“GRADE(Grading of Recommendations for Assessment, Development and Evaluation)”的研究旨在通过系统化的评估过程,确保医学建议的准...

    0AI文章2025-05-25
  • 基于Web的移动应用开发,技术趋势与未来展望

    在当今数字化时代,随着互联网和移动设备的发展,越来越多的企业和个人开始转向基于Web的应用开发,这种模式不仅为用户提供了更加便捷、个性化的生活体验,也为开发者们带来了前所未有的机遇和挑战,本文将探讨基于Web的移动应用开发的主要技术趋势,并对未来的发展进行一些预测。...

    0AI文章2025-05-25
  • 深入解析,连接池与ORM框架在数据库管理中的应用

    在现代软件开发中,高效管理和优化数据库性能已成为开发者必须面对的重要课题,为了提高应用程序的响应速度、减少资源消耗以及增强系统的可维护性,使用连接池和ORM(对象关系映射)框架成为了许多开发者的首选方案。 连接池:构建高效数据访问的基础 连接池是一种设计模式,它通过...

    0AI文章2025-05-25
  • 密码应用改造,提升安全性与用户体验的双刃剑

    在数字化时代,个人信息安全已成为人们关注的重点,随着技术的发展和网络安全威胁的不断升级,传统的密码管理方式已经难以满足现代用户的需求,对密码应用进行改造成为了一个亟待解决的问题,本文将探讨密码应用改造的重要性、当前面临的挑战以及未来的发展方向。 密码应用改造的重要性...

    0AI文章2025-05-25
  • 网络安全攻防实战—Web渗透测试与防护策略

    在当今数字化时代,网络安全已经成为了一个不容忽视的重要议题,随着互联网的普及和数据的日益增长,企业、组织和个人都面临着来自黑客和恶意软件的威胁,为了保障系统的安全性,进行有效的网络防御至关重要,本文将探讨Web渗透测试的基本概念、方法以及实际操作中的注意事项,同时介绍如...

    0AI文章2025-05-25
  • 网站法律法规的重要性与遵守指南

    在数字化时代,互联网已成为人们日常生活不可或缺的一部分,随着网络的普及和使用,如何确保网站的安全性和合规性成为了一个不容忽视的问题,网站不仅是信息传播的重要平台,也是法律和法规实施的载体,遵守网站法律法规不仅关乎个人隐私、数据安全,更是对企业和公众权益的保护。 理解网...

    0AI文章2025-05-25
  • 学习如何制作自己的网页视频教程

    在数字化时代,学习和分享知识已经成为了一种时尚,而如果你是一个对网页设计和技术感兴趣的爱好者或初学者,那么你可能会想要自己动手创建一个网页视频教程来分享你的技能和经验,这不仅能够帮助他人快速掌握相关技术,还能让你的创造力得到展示和发挥,本文将为你提供一个详细的网页制作视...

    0AI文章2025-05-25